Goodlife Fitness, the largest health club company in Canada, says that every Canadian can get Canadian strong.
The brand’s latest spot features a diverse cast (both men and women of different races and body types) doing all kinds of workouts, in an attempt to highlight that we can all become stronger. Serving as soundtrack is the 2019 single “Champion” by Book & Haviah Mighty.
“At GoodLife Fitness, our purpose is to give every Canadian the opportunity to live a fit and healthy good life,” the company declared in a press statement last year. GoodLife Fitness has over 255+ locations across Canada and many gyms open 24 hours a day. Following the 2015 partnership with 24 Hour Fitness in the US, GoodLife Fitness members are able use over 400 locations with their Canada-Wide membership across the U.S. and vice versa.
The title sponsor of two marathons (one taking place in Victoria, British Columbia and the other in Toronto, Ontario), GoodLife Fitness also has a foundation called GoodLife Kids Foundation, which aims to help all kids have the opportunity to benefit from an active life.
